Abstract
Appearance and growth of near-wall low-speed streaks are examined in the transition process of boundary layer relaminarized by suction through a short strip of perforated wall. Near-wall streaks are almost completely suppressed by the boundary-layer suction. Immediately downstream of the suction strip, residual turbulent fluctuations convecting from upstream can generate low-speed streaks. Subsequently the streaks break down due to their instability, leading to retransition to wall turbulence. The low-frequency fluctuations associated with the near-wall streaks are found to grow algebraically up to 10 percent of the free-stream velocity in term of r.m.s. value of u-fluctuation. The spacing of near-wall streaks appearing in the retransition process is not so different from that of developed wall turbulence without suction.
